A flotilla is a collective noun used to describe a group or fleet of ships, boats, or vessels sailing or traveling together in a coordinated manner. Derived from the Spanish word "flota," meaning a fleet, flotilla refers to a specific type of maritime gathering, typically consisting of smaller-sized vessels or military craft of various types. These organized groups can come together for several reasons, including naval operations, scientific expeditions, pleasure cruises, or even fishing expeditions.

A flotilla can range in size, from a few vessels to sometimes hundreds of ships, all relying on each other for support and mutual protection. Historical examples of flotillas include the naval forces of ancient civilizations like the Phoenicians and Vikings, who employed flotillas to explore new territories and facilitate trade across vast maritime routes.

Modern-day flotillas are often seen participating in military operations or exercises, affecting a powerful display of unity and strength. These can be witnessed during naval parades, international drills, or joint training exercises conducted by navies worldwide. Flotillas may also have a humanitarian or peacekeeping purpose. In such cases, they could involve vessels providing aid during a crisis, responding to natural disasters, or contributing to peacekeeping missions across different regions.

Bearing a sense of collective purpose, a flotilla sustains a significant level of coordination and teamwork among its members. The vessels operate in unity, displaying efficient communication, strategic maneuvering, and a clear chain of command. Whether shifting formations, launching combined operations, or working in tandem against potential threats, flotillas exemplify the power of collaboration to accomplish shared objectives.

In summary, the term flotilla is used to describe a collective noun referring to a grouping of ships or boats navigating together, exhibiting cohesive coordination and purpose. It encapsulates the strength, cooperation, and symbiotic relationship necessary for maritime endeavors, making it an important concept in both historical and contemporary seafaring contexts.
